Title :
Radar cross-section calculation for unmanned aerial vehicle

Abstract :
The radar cross-section (RCS) calculation method for unmanned aerial vehicles (UAVs) is considered. UAV configuration supposes the presence of internal perfectly electrically conducting (PEC) elements under dielectric envelope. Also UAV can include external PEC elements and fully dielectric elements. The simulation of RCS for UAV model has been carried out. It is shown that main contribution to UAVs´ RCS is brought by PEC elements placed inside dielectric envelope and outside it. Also contribution of dielectric envelope and dielectric elements has been estimated.
